K102 TTN is a 1993 Vauxhall Astra in Red with a 1,389c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 3 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 33.3%.
Across all 1993 Vauxhall Astra models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.6% with a typical mileage of 106,159 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Astra f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 1,048,496 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K102 TTN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Astra typ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 33 years old, this Vauxhall Astra is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
